(6) Share-Based Compensation
During the quarter and six months ended September 30, 2011, we granted 0.2 million and 1.6 million nonvested stock units, respectively, at a weighted average grant price of $45.72 and $52.73, respectively, to our executive officers, non-executive employees and non-employee board members, consisting of both time-based and market-based awards. Time-based nonvested stock units vest in annual increments over one or three years. Market-based nonvested stock units vest in 50% increments over two- and three-year periods upon achievement of certain targets related to our relative shareholder return as compared to the NASDAQ-100 Index over each performance period.
During the quarter and six months ended September 30, 2011, we issued 0.1 million and 1.0 million shares of common stock, respectively, related to exercises of stock options and 0.2 million and 1.4 million shares of common stock, respectively, related to vesting of restricted stock units.
At September 30, 2011, we had approximately $209.8 million of total unrecognized compensation costs related to share-based awards that are expected to be recognized as expense over a remaining weighted-average period of two years.
